Output e7033e8656d770e80f80e16c58d1d48f7f94d10c5d7d0f7e7a64fae2f0aa26e9:1

value
24639154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b638dcf9a33684edfa73d08e957d93e897510d3 OP_EQUAL
address
32jEcnQ3ydSdAsnL27oKHEr6XgojpT4dtx
transaction
e7033e8656d770e80f80e16c58d1d48f7f94d10c5d7d0f7e7a64fae2f0aa26e9
confirmations
383637
spent
true